In the first six months of 2018, 246 cruise ships visited Croatian ports, 10 more than in the same period in 2017, and aboard those vessels were 356,607 passengers, or 12.6% more than in 2017, show figures recently released by the national statistical office (DZS).

The statistics show that in the H1 2018, there were 4.2% more cruises than in the same period of 2017.

As in the previous years, most of the visiting ships (55) sailed under the flags of Malta and the Bahamas each, followed by those sailing under the flags of Panama (43) and Italy (39).

The most visited port was the port of Dubrovnik, followed by Split, and Korčula. (Hina)
